Our industry-leading underlay production journey

We operate a responsible, resourceful and safe business. We commit to, and invest in, reducing waste. We are proud of our achievements and will continue to push forward to enhance everyday life.

1989

Our sustainable journey begins

Ball & Young are purchased by The Vita Group to develop the use of recycled PU trim foam

1995

Game changing industry first

Award-winning Cloud 9 is launched, pioneering the use of PU trim foam in underlay manufacture

1998

High density underlays developed

Cloud 9 high density underlays launched, another industry first

2002

Underlay for marine use approved

Cloud 9 flame retardant range is launched and approved for marine use

2010

Carbon footprint reduced by logistic efficiencies

Ball & Young block plant investment, reduces vehicle movements between sites

2015

Another game changer: anti-bacterial underlay

Another first... Ultra-fresh underlay stays fresher for longer with anti-bacterial treatment

2017

Unusable trim gets new lease of life!

Re-purposing previously unusable trim, Cloud 9 Eco-Cushion is launched for use with artificial grass

2019

Cloud 9, the proven choice for healthy homes

Cloud 9 products are certified for indoor air quality control

2021

Take-back underlay off-cut initiative launched

Post fitting off-cuts will be diverted away from landfill in this new scheme

Electricity from 100% renewable sources

Since March 2021, electricity comes from 100% renewable sources, backed by EAC’s (Energy Attribute Certificates) or REGO’s (Renewable Energy Guarantees of Origin)
